The Bernoullis: When Math is the Family Business

TL;DR

The Bernoullis, a family of mathematicians from the 17th and 18th centuries, made significant contributions to probability theory, calculus, fluid dynamics, and physics, leaving their names on principles and concepts still taught today.

Key Insights

  • 👪 The Bernoulli family consisted of eight mathematically gifted individuals across three generations, who made significant contributions to various fields, including probability theory, calculus, fluid dynamics, and physics.
  • 💦 Jacob Bernoulli's work on the law of large numbers and the Bernoulli distribution laid the foundation for probability theory.
  • 📏 Johann Bernoulli's discoveries in calculus, such as the brachistochrone problem and l'Hôpital's rule, expanded the understanding of mathematical concepts.
  • 🫢 Daniel Bernoulli's contributions to fluid dynamics, risk measurement, and gas behavior have practical applications in fields such as engineering and physics.
  • 💦 The Bernoullis' success can be attributed to their talent, the timing of their work coinciding with the invention of calculus, and their ability to utilize mathematical tools to uncover new insights.

Questions & Answers

Q: What were Jacob Bernoulli's major contributions to mathematics?

Jacob Bernoulli proved the law of large numbers and developed the Bernoulli distribution, which are fundamental concepts in probability theory.

Q: How did Johann Bernoulli contribute to calculus?

Johann Bernoulli solved the brachistochrone problem using calculus and discovered l'Hôpital's rule, which is still used in mathematics today.

Q: What is Bernoulli's principle?

Bernoulli's principle, developed by Daniel Bernoulli, describes the relationship between pressure and speed in a moving fluid and is relevant in understanding phenomena such as airplane flight.

Q: What are some of Daniel Bernoulli's other contributions?

Daniel Bernoulli also worked on Euler-Bernoulli beam theory, which is widely used in engineering for analyzing beams in structures. He also developed methods for measuring risk and studied gas behavior.
